------- Additional Comments From ebourg@apache.org  2005-04-07 20:15 -------
I'm a bit reluctant to follow this path, Commons Configuration is well suited
for simple configuration purposes (i.e properties of simple types like int,
String, float, Date, arrays...), but not for marshalling/unmarshalling complex
objects. There is a ton of frameworks already adressing this issue (Castor,
betwixt, digester, JAXB, JDK 1.4 XMLEncoder/Decoder...) and this is not a
trivial problem, do we really want to solve it once again ?
